    Wow was this good! The cake was moist and the crumble topping was crunchy but the highlight was the roasted pineapple tidbits - sweet, tangy and a little juicy (almost better than fresh). I used only half the butter and sugar to roast the pineapple as there was quite a lot of liquid when it came time to turn the spears and I lined the cake pan with parchment to avoid having to either cut the pieces in the pan or invert the cake.
